Edible oyster mushrooms growing on used coffee grounds The current commercial farming system is liable for high power expenses for the transport of foodstuffs.


The energy utilized to move food is decreased when metropolitan farming can provide cities with locally grown food. Pirog located that traditional, non-local, food distribution system utilized 4 to 17 times extra fuel and released 5 to 17 times extra CO2 than the regional and local transport. Likewise, in a research by Marc Xuereb and Region of Waterloo Public Health And Wellness, it was estimated that changing to locally-grown food can save transport-related discharges equal to almost 50,000 statistics lots of CO2, or the equivalent of taking 16,191 vehicles off the roadway.

Plants soak up climatic co2 (CARBON DIOXIDE) and release breathable oxygen (O2) with photosynthesis. The process of Carbon Sequestration can be better improved by incorporating other farming techniques to boost elimination from the ambience and avoid the launch of CO2 during harvest. This process counts heavily on the kinds of plants chosen and the technique of farming.





The decrease in ozone and other particulate matter can profit human wellness. Decreasing these particulates and ozone gases might lower mortality rates in urban areas together with boost the wellness of those living in cities. A 2011 article discovered that a rooftop consisting of 2000 m2 of uncut lawn has the possible to remove up to 4000 kg of particulate matter and that one square meter of eco-friendly roofing suffices to counter the yearly particulate matter discharges of an auto. The implementation of metropolitan farming in these vacant whole lots can be an economical approach for getting rid of these chemicals. In the procedure referred to as Phytoremediation, plants and the associated microorganisms are selected for their chemical ability to degrade, soak up, convert to an check inert type, and remove contaminants from the dirt.


Mercury and lead), inorganic substances (e.g. Arsenic and Uranium), and natural substances (e.g. petroleum and chlorinated compounds like PBCs) (balcony and patio garden design). Phytoremeditation is both an environmentally-friendly, economical and energy-efficient measure to lower pollution. Phytoremediation just costs regarding $5$40 per lots of dirt being decontaminated. Execution of this process also reduces the amount of dirt that should be thrown away in a dangerous waste land fill.

Urban agriculture is associated with boosted usage of fruits and veggies which reduces risk for illness and can be a cost-effective way to supply people with quality, fresh produce in metropolitan setups. Produce from city gardens can be viewed to be extra delicious and preferable than shop bought fruit and vegetables which may likewise lead to a wider approval and higher intake.


1). Garden-based education and learning can likewise produce nutritional advantages in kids. An Idaho research reported a positive association between college gardens and enhanced consumption of fruit, veggies, vitamin A, vitamin C and fiber amongst sixth graders. Collecting fruits and veggies initiates the enzymatic procedure of nutrient destruction which is especially destructive to water soluble vitamins such as ascorbic acid and thiamin.


Urban agriculture additionally gives high quality nutrition for low-income houses. Lots of urban yards decrease the strain on food financial institutions and other emergency situation food companies by donating shares of their harvest and giving fresh produce in locations that otherwise could be food deserts.
